Patents Examined by Patrick Riegler
  • Patent number: 9773213
    Abstract: A solution for providing an instant messaging (IM) space, such as for a chat session, is provided, which includes provisions for spinning off of chat threads. An embodiment of the invention provides a method of providing an IM space, the method comprising: providing a first graphical user interface (GUI) space for an IM conversation; obtaining a selected portion of the IM conversation represented on the first GUI; and creating a second GUI space for a second IM conversation based on the portion selected.
    Type: Grant
    Filed: March 27, 2012
    Date of Patent: September 26, 2017
    Assignee: International Business Machines Corporation
    Inventors: Anuphinh P. Wanderski, John M. Lance, Andrew L. Schirmer
  • Patent number: 9753602
    Abstract: Systems and method are provided for providing a playlist transport bar. The playlist transport bar provides an overlay which graphically represents assets (e.g., programs) of a playlist in a manner that enables a user to simultaneously ascertain a playback position within the playlist and a particular asset. The playlist transport may include asset regions which each correspond to an asset in a playlist and a position indication region which may provide information relating to a playback position.
    Type: Grant
    Filed: June 14, 2013
    Date of Patent: September 5, 2017
    Assignee: Rovi Guides, Inc.
    Inventors: Jon P. Radloff, Danny R. Gaydou, II, Thomas J. Carroll, Mark Heyner, Kenneth F. Carpenter, Jr.
  • Patent number: 9754286
    Abstract: One or more embodiments of the disclosure include methods and systems that allows for improved user navigation within a group of content items. For example, a content navigation system can identify a content item within a group of content items to provide to a user in response to a user interaction. In some embodiments, the content navigation system can identify a content item to provide to the user based on one or more factors, such as a characteristic of a user interaction and a relevance of a content item. In addition, the content navigation system can strategically provide advertisement content items to a user by adjusting one or more factors with respect to advertisement content items.
    Type: Grant
    Filed: September 22, 2014
    Date of Patent: September 5, 2017
    Assignee: FACEBOOK, INC.
    Inventor: Mark A. Richardson
  • Patent number: 9740394
    Abstract: A display/input device has a display portion and a touch panel portion. The display portion displays selection keys and displays a setting screen of a selected setting item. The touch panel portion is provided for the display portion to detect a touch position of user input and a tap-and-drag operation in which while a touch is maintained the touched position is moved. When a tap-and-drag operation is detected within the display position of a selection key, the display portion displays a setting item explanation screen that explains the setting item corresponding to the selection key at the position where the tap-and-drag operation has been made.
    Type: Grant
    Filed: September 25, 2013
    Date of Patent: August 22, 2017
    Assignee: KYOCERA Document Solutions Inc.
    Inventor: Hiroshi Nakagawa
  • Patent number: 9740194
    Abstract: A machine can be accessed and controlled with the help of an interface device. The customizable interface device contains device elements that define features relating to the external representation and internal functionality of the interface device, as linked to one or more machines. An operator can use a configuration station to implement single or reoccurring queries that interact with the interface device and corresponding machines. In particular, the queries target the configuration of device elements in the interface device. The process can include temporarily unloading unused features from active memory and mirroring property changes initialized by a source. An emulator can assist in the configuration process by providing a preliminary software representation of the interface device hardware. A user can develop, test, and reconfigure functions on the emulator before loading the finalized platform to the interface device.
    Type: Grant
    Filed: February 18, 2010
    Date of Patent: August 22, 2017
    Assignee: ROCKWELL AUTOMATION TECHNOLOGIES, INC.
    Inventors: Krista Kummerfeldt Mann, Robert F. Lloyd, Steven Mark Cisler, Clinton D. Britt, Joseph Francis Mann
  • Patent number: 9729403
    Abstract: One embodiment is directed to a method performed by a computing device. The method includes (1) receiving a command from a user to display a current GUI page of a set of GUI pages on a client device, the set of GUI pages providing the user with control over a system, (2) selecting, with reference to a proficiency level associated with the user, a version of the current GUI page from a plurality of versions of the current GUI page, and (3) causing the selected version of the current GUI page to be displayed to the user on a display of the client device. Other embodiments are directed to a computerized apparatus and a computer program product for performing a method similar to that described above.
    Type: Grant
    Filed: March 15, 2013
    Date of Patent: August 8, 2017
    Assignee: EMC IP Holding Company LLC
    Inventors: Bruce R. Rabe, Kendra Marchant, Rhon L. Porter
  • Patent number: 9703760
    Abstract: Systems and methods for rendering an annotation graphic user interface (GUI) that encompasses external information related to a book term in a structured frame. An ebook includes pre-selected terms embedded with hyperlinks directing to an article contained by an external information source. Upon a user interaction with such a pre-selected term, raw information from the one or more articles is accessed and fed to a wireframe. The raw information is mapped to respective sections of the wireframe based on the field identifications attached to different segments of the raw information. As a result, an annotation GUI including the external information can be displayed in a consistent and orderly format.
    Type: Grant
    Filed: August 12, 2013
    Date of Patent: July 11, 2017
    Assignee: RAKUTEN KOBO INC.
    Inventors: Tony O'Donoghue, James Wu
  • Patent number: 9699351
    Abstract: Methods, system and computer-readable media are disclosed to facilitate presenting a plurality of digital images in a user interface window that includes an image display region and at least one other region available for re-use, receiving input from a user indicating a selection of at least one of the digital images, and modifying the presentation of the user interface window to present the selected at least one digital image in the image display region and to present the non-selected digital images as thumbnail images displayed within the at least one other region available for re-use. The thumbnail images displayed in the re-use region may be selectively displayed in a more prominent manner to facilitate user interaction.
    Type: Grant
    Filed: September 29, 2010
    Date of Patent: July 4, 2017
    Assignee: Apple Inc.
    Inventor: Joshua David Fagans
  • Patent number: 9696872
    Abstract: Dynamic display of hierarchical data in the form of a treemap. A first instance of an object representation is selected in a first visualization of a hierarchy encoded by containment. A second instance of the object representation is designated, wherein each instance is a tier for object occupation. An object within the hierarchy is displayed as a shape comprising at least two opposing surfaces, and the object is selected through the opposing surfaces. The hierarchy is dynamically re-ordered in response to the selection and designation, and the second representation of the hierarchy is displayed based on the dynamic re-ordering.
    Type: Grant
    Filed: May 21, 2013
    Date of Patent: July 4, 2017
    Assignee: International Business Machines Corporation
    Inventors: Matthew R. Claycomb, Trenton J. Johnson, James L. Lentz, Dana L. Price, Charmant K. Tan, Ramratan Vennam
  • Patent number: 9672478
    Abstract: Embodiments of the present invention relate to techniques for creating policies. A plurality of objects representative of semantic objects are provided to a user. An arrangement of a subset of the objects, the arrangement representative of a policy, is received. The arrangement is converted to instructions for implementation by an application configured to implement policies. One or more of the objects may include fields and/or controls for specifying criteria of semantic objects represented by the objects.
    Type: Grant
    Filed: February 26, 2010
    Date of Patent: June 6, 2017
    Assignee: ORACLE INTERNATIONAL CORPORATION
    Inventors: Reza B'Far, Lloyd Boucher, Ryan Golden, Yasin Cengiz, Tsai-Ming Tseng, Logan Goh, Nigel Jacobs, Malini Chakrabarti, Huyvu Nguyen, Mark Stebelton
  • Patent number: 9621691
    Abstract: A handheld electronic device includes a reduced QWERTY keyboard and is enabled with disambiguation software. The device provides output in the form of a default output and a number of variants. The output is based largely upon the frequency, i.e., the likelihood that a user intended a particular output, but various features of the device provide additional variants that are not based solely on frequency and rather are provided by various logic structures resident on the device. The device enables editing during text entry and also provides a learning function that allows the disambiguation function to adapt to provide a customized experience for the user. The disambiguation function can be selectively disabled and an alternate keystroke interpretation system provided.
    Type: Grant
    Filed: April 8, 2014
    Date of Patent: April 11, 2017
    Assignee: BlackBerry Limited
    Inventors: Vadim Fux, Michael G. Elizarov, Sergey V. Kolomiets
  • Patent number: 9600595
    Abstract: In a method for redrawing a two web page windows that are being moved from a first display screen to a second display screen, an indication is received that each respective web page window is being moved from a first display to a second display. A processor identifies different scaling factors corresponding to uniform resource locators (URLs) of each respective web page window for scaling the web page windows for display on the second display screen. The processor causes the first web page window to be scaled according to the first scaling factor and the second web page window to be scaled according to the second, different scaling factor, wherein each web page window is scaled differently relative to the other on the second display screen than on the first display screen.
    Type: Grant
    Filed: May 21, 2013
    Date of Patent: March 21, 2017
    Assignee: International Business Machines Corporation
    Inventors: Lisa Seacat DeLuca, Dana L. Price, Shelbee D. Smith-Eigenbrode
  • Patent number: 9582519
    Abstract: In the proposed approach cluster elements (bins) are made available as a keypad in the form of a cluster map. The user directly selects the cluster element (bin) with a mouse, touch or actual keypad. For each of the associated attributes, a cluster map is available that orders the attributes from high-to-low by color or shade intensity. When a cluster element is selected in one cluster map, that same cluster element is also highlighted in other cluster maps. For each of the cluster maps, a value axis is available which shows the value of the parameter for the selected cluster element. In the case of numerical values, the high/low attribute pattern across the cluster maps is easily visible. The selected data objects in the cluster map are displayed in a separate widget.
    Type: Grant
    Filed: August 15, 2013
    Date of Patent: February 28, 2017
    Assignee: Dassault Systemes Simulia Corp.
    Inventor: Alexander Jacobus Maria Van der Velden
  • Patent number: 9582167
    Abstract: Managing the delivery of a presentation in real-time includes receiving a presentation including a plurality of slides, wherein each slide of the plurality of slides is allocated an amount of time for display during delivery of the presentation and is associated with a slide subject, determining subjects of interest for an audience of the presentation from a social media website, and correlating, using a processor, the subjects of interest with the plurality of slides of the presentation. A recommendation is generated using the processor. The recommendation specifies a modification to the presentation according to the correlation of subjects of interest with the plurality of slides of the presentation. Further, the recommendation is indicated using a display.
    Type: Grant
    Filed: August 14, 2013
    Date of Patent: February 28, 2017
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Suzanne O. Livingston, Ethan L. Perry, Scott H. Prager
  • Patent number: 9563605
    Abstract: A command center system includes forms to receive incident data describing an incident and at least one incident list that is populated with incident data from the input forms. The system also includes a status page that includes a list of links to incident pages, each incident page constructed from incident data in the at least one incident list. The status page also includes a daily briefing link to a daily briefing page that is constructed once per day from incident data in the at least one incident list such that incident data added after the current daily briefing page is constructed are not included in the daily briefing page. The status page also includes an incident content feed link for a content feed of incident data added to the at least one incident list and a daily briefing content feed link for a content feed of daily briefing pages.
    Type: Grant
    Filed: May 29, 2012
    Date of Patent: February 7, 2017
    Assignee: Target Brands, Inc.
    Inventors: Aaron M. Bergquist, Tanea Marie Bement, Bray Alexander Wheeler, Ann Michelle Mielke
  • Patent number: 9563850
    Abstract: Methods, systems and computer program products for displaying geographical locations with the one or more annotations. In a particular embodiment, a language model is used to obtain the probability distribution of the locations over one or more annotations. Further, the system and the method utilizes the probability data obtained from the language model to determine a probability score for each location over the one or more annotations. Subsequently, one or more geographical locations are displayed on a world map, based on the probability score of the geographical locations over the one or more annotations. In one embodiment, geographical locations may be highlighted using a color code on a heat map overlaid on the world map. The color code may represent the ranking of the geographical locations based on the calculated probability score for each identified geographical location.
    Type: Grant
    Filed: January 13, 2010
    Date of Patent: February 7, 2017
    Assignee: Yahoo! Inc.
    Inventors: Roelof van Zwol, Vanessa Murdock, Lluís Garcia Pueyo
  • Patent number: 9554689
    Abstract: A method for demonstrating a domestic appliance, the domestic appliance having a controller, a display, and at least one user input component, the method comprising: displaying a plurality of images in accordance with a predetermined order on the display; while displaying a first image of the plurality of images in accordance with the predetermined order on the display, detecting at least one user input that is provided to the at least one user input component; responsive to the at least one user input, displaying a second image of the plurality of images that is associated with the at least one user input on the display for an amount of time; and subsequent to the amount of time, displaying the plurality of images on the display in accordance with the predetermined order resuming with a third image, said second image being different from said first image and said third image.
    Type: Grant
    Filed: January 17, 2013
    Date of Patent: January 31, 2017
    Assignee: BSH Home Appliances Corporation
    Inventors: Raphael Guilleminot, Phillip Montanye, Graham Sadtler, Elysa Soffer, Robert Tannen
  • Patent number: 9553947
    Abstract: A system, method and various user interfaces provide an embedded web-based video player for navigating video playlists and playing video content. A website publisher can create and store a video player with customized parameters (e.g., player type, appearance, advertising options, etc.) and can associate the player with a playlist of selected videos. The stored video player is associated with a player ID in a player database and can be embedded in a website using an embed code referencing the player ID. A user interface for the embedded player provides controls for controlling video playback and for controlling the selection of a video from the playlist.
    Type: Grant
    Filed: July 18, 2007
    Date of Patent: January 24, 2017
    Assignee: Google Inc.
    Inventors: Jasson Schrock, Gunthar Hartwig, Nikhil Chandhok, Christian Oestlien, Aaron Lee
  • Patent number: 9535991
    Abstract: A video display apparatus for displaying a catalog of one or more candidate video items for replay, each video item being represented in the catalog by a catalog entry having at least one displayed representative image comprises a user control device operable to resize a displayed catalog entry by a select-and-drag operation; and means responsive to a resizing of a catalog entry to select a number of distinct representative images, for display in respect of that video item, so that the number displayed increases with increasing size of the catalog entry while the display size of each representative image stays substantially constant with respect to changes in the catalog entry size.
    Type: Grant
    Filed: December 8, 2005
    Date of Patent: January 3, 2017
    Assignee: SONY EUROPE LIMITED
    Inventor: David William Trepess
  • Patent number: 9529516
    Abstract: Disclosed are systems, methods, and non-transitory computer-readable storage media for scrolling a virtual keyboard on a touch screen device including a display. A first aspect allows detecting a user contact swipe motion in a predetermined direction along said keyboard, scrolling said keyboard across said display in accordance with said motion, and stopping said scrolling upon termination of user contact swipe motion. A second aspect allows scrolling of a virtual keyboard to snap to an intelligent position based on a song key or relative minor of the song key. A third aspect allows a note to be held when a user's finger remains in contact with the display even though the finger is no longer in contact with a key linked to the note on the keyboard as a result of scrolling.
    Type: Grant
    Filed: August 16, 2013
    Date of Patent: December 27, 2016
    Assignee: Apple Inc.
    Inventors: Christof Adam, Elliott Harris